But the one who examines me is The Lord

"For the kingdom of God does not consist in words but in power." (1 Corinthians 4:20)

 Do you see the transformation that perfect Love's obedience brings in your life? Do you see it in the lives of those closest to you? Do you see it in the fruit borne of your engagement with anybody that God places in front of you on a given day?
 It is easy to say "I love you God", easier still mouth the words "Lord, Lord" when we consider loving Him. But the acid test is power that comes from obedience. Is anything about you different? Is His life alive in you affecting change? If not, why not?

"If you love Me, you will keep My commandments." (John 14:15)

Jesus' Love says "Go and Do." Love from a pure heart, a good conscience, and a sincere Faith (1 Timothy 1:5) changes lives and scatters all darkness; It mends wounds, heals sickness and disease, it demolishes every stronghold and extinguishes every flaming arrow that Satan can muster. (2 Corinthians 10:3-5, Ephesians 6:16)

"Little children, let us not love with word or with tongue, but in deed and truth. We will know by this that we are of the truth, and will assure our heart before Him in whatever our heart condemns us; for God is greater than our heart and knows all things." (1 John 3:18-20)

It may be hard to do or hard for you to want to do, but it's also the simplest thing you will ever attempt.

Step 1 - Love God
Step 2- Let your answer to Him, regardless of the request, be "yes Lord"
Step 3 - Get out of bed every morning and just show up.

Put feet to your Faith in God's power. I guarantee you will see Him move and experience His perfect peace in the process. No matter what the situation or circumstance, He may not do what you expect in the way you expect it, but it will always be Him and it will always be good.

"Do not be surprised, my brothers and sisters, if the world hates you. We know that we have passed from death to life, because we love each other. Anyone who does not love remains in death. (1 John 3:13-14)
